Hello there.

So for a while now I've been hosting from my own machine a SRCDS server (specifically Team Fortress 2). My IP and port can be seen by everyone (it is port forwarded correctly) it can be pinged by everyone. However, some players in TF2 cannot connect to the server.

I've been doing a lot of troubleshooting myself and found a very unstable "fix"; each player that CAN'T join must change their clientport manually in order to get in the server. Thing is, other players with the default 27005 clientport can connect just fine.

The players that CAN'T join can ping the server just fine, so my ports are forwarded correctly since the world can see my IP. However, they can't connect to the server. They get the famous Connection failed after 4 retries, as if they couldn't even see my IP in the first place, which they can.

So I don't know what could be causing this. It's been 2 weeks since this started and this is still happening. Anyone else has this problem? Anyone knows anything about this?

They can ping my IP on the port 27015 (The port I'm hosting the server on / hostport).

Clientport is a cvar that you can set either on the server or on the client's end. So if they change the clientport value on the client's end to some other port they CAN join.

The hostport is 27015, clientport is 27005. They're both default like they should be.
